| payload |
{"artifact_id":"art_memory_curation_tr {"artifact_id":"art_memory_curation_trace_thr_61116ac967a08d1f07_60","candidate_count":1,"kind":"memory_curation_trace","operation_count":1,"reasoning_trace":{"steps":[{"decision":"finalize","finalize_reason":"Persist mem_breakeven_2500 (breakeven_value=2500, currency=$) as durable memory, scoped to default/global or at least medium durability, since it is a stated personal constraint used for future target-setting.","iteration":1,"missing_facts":[],"reasoning":"The candidate memory mem_breakeven_2500 is already grounded in explicit user evidence ($2500 is my breakeven number) with a clear durable preference/constraint (breakeven threshold). No missing facts block keeping it; no conflicting or duplicate memory evidence is provided that would require merge/deprecate. Therefore, persist this memory as-is.","tool_name":""}],"terminated_reason":"finalized","tool_calls":[]},"source_event_ids":["evt_c7bf5dc4f70b"],"status":"ready","summary":"Stored the user\u2019s explicit breakeven threshold ($2,500) as durable profile constraint memory.","thread_id":"thr_61116ac967a08d1f07"}... |